Understanding the Essence of British Conversations

British conversations are characterized by their rich linguistic variety and cultural depth. Unlike standardized textbook English, real-life dialogues often include slang, regional accents, humor, and subtle social cues that can be challenging for non-native speakers.

The Importance of Context and Cultural References

In British conversations, context plays a pivotal role in meaning. For example, phrases like “Fancy a cuppa?” or “It’s chucking it down” might confuse learners unfamiliar with British culture. Understanding these expressions requires not just language skills but also cultural insight.

Key Features of British Conversations

To effectively learn british conversations, it’s crucial to recognize their defining elements:

1. Politeness and Indirectness

British speakers tend to use polite language and indirect requests to maintain social harmony. For example, instead of saying “Give me that,” a British person might say, “Could you pass me that, please?”

2. Use of Fillers and Pauses

Fillers such as “well,” “you know,” and “like” are common in everyday speech, giving conversations a natural rhythm and allowing speakers to think.

3. Question Tags

British English frequently employs question tags to confirm information, such as “It’s cold today, isn’t it?” These tags soften statements and encourage responses.

4. Unique Vocabulary and Slang

Learning british conversations means becoming familiar with slang terms like “bloke” (man), “loo” (toilet), and “knackered” (tired).

Strategies to Improve Your British Conversation Skills

Mastering british conversations requires focused practice and exposure. Here are some effective techniques:

1. Engage with Authentic Content

Listening to British podcasts, watching TV series, and following British news channels can help familiarize you with natural speech patterns and vocabulary.

2. Practice Speaking Regularly

Using platforms like Talkpal allows learners to engage in real-time conversations with native speakers, enhancing fluency and confidence.

3. Study Common Phrases and Expressions

Memorizing and practicing idiomatic expressions and everyday phrases will make your speech more natural.

4. Record and Review Your Conversations

Recording your practice sessions enables you to identify areas for improvement and track progress.

5. Focus on Pronunciation and Accent

British English has diverse accents. Start with Received Pronunciation (RP) or a region-specific accent based on your goals and try to emulate the intonation and stress patterns.

Examples of British Conversation Snippets

Practicing with real conversation samples can boost your understanding. Here are some typical exchanges:

Example 1: Casual Greeting

A: “Alright, mate? Fancy a pint later?”

B: “Sounds good! Where shall we meet?”

Example 2: Discussing the Weather

A: “It’s absolutely chucking it down today, isn’t it?”

B: “Yeah, typical British weather!”

Example 3: Asking for Help Politely

A: “Could you possibly give me a hand with this?”

B: “Of course, happy to help.”
